Abstract
An upper bound is established for the magnitude of the truncation error incurred when a real-valued finite energy signal that is bandlimited to-\pi r \leq \omega \leq \pi r, 0 < r < 1, is approximated by2N + 1terms from its Shannon sampling series expansion with the samples taken at the integer points. The derived bound is an improvement on known results.Keywords
